Lady Rebels ready for Hawai’i in opening round of WBIT
Stephen Lew-Imagn Images

The UNLV Lady Rebels have claimed the No. 2 seed in the 2025 Women’s Basketball Invitation Tournament.

They will host Hawai’i on Thursday, March 20 at 6:30pm PT at the Cox Pavillion.

This marks the fourth consecutive season that the Lady Rebels have participated in the postseason and their first time in the WBIT, which is only in its second year.

The Lady Rebels are 34-16 all time against Hawai’i. The Lady rebels were victorious in their last meeting 76-66 in Hawai’i.

UNLV have won the last three of five games.

Hawai’i is unseeded in the 32-team field and have an 22-9 overall record. The Rainbow Wahine just suffered a loss to UC San Diego on Friday, 51-49 in the Big West Championship Semifinals.

The Rainbow Wahine are led by Lily Wahinekapu, averaging 11.2 points per game. Ritorya Tamilo leads the Rainbow Wahine in rebounding, grabbing down 5.1 rebounds per game.

Amarachi Kimpson continues to lead the Lady Rebels in scoring and field goals per game. Kimpson averages 14.2 points per game and makes 5.2 field goals per game.

Kiara Jackson is the second leading Lady Rebel averaging 12.6 points per game and 4.9 assists per game.

The game will be televised on ESPN+ at 6:30pm PT.
